How Optical Tracking Marker Spheres allow exact movement seize
Optical tracking marker spheres are engineered for unmatched precision in movement capture. These spherical markers use retro-reflective supplies to mirror infrared light, enabling cameras and systems to track their site with Remarkable accuracy. suitable for industries that demand actual-time movement Examination, like healthcare and producing, these markers make sure steadiness and reliability.
